GOT IT The assumption that rewards and punishments influence our choices between different courses of action underlies economic, sociological, psychological, and legal thinking about human action. Hence, the notion of a reasoning criminal -one who employs the same sorts of cognitive strategies when contemplating offending as they and the rest of us use when making other decisions -might seem a small An international group of researchers in criminology, psychology, and economics provide a comprehensive review of original research on the criminal offender as a reasoning decision maker. This volume develops an alternative approach, termed the "rational choice perspective," to explain criminal behavior. The reasoning criminal:rational choice perspectives on offending.
